I'm picking up a used 3point wood splitter for the back of my 4047. Having never used one before, I understand how to hook up the hoses but not sure if there is something I am missing. How does the splitter get pressure from the rear remotes? Do I need to hold open the control lever for the remote with a bungee or something? Please forgive my ignorance and thanks in advance.
 
/ Log splitter hydraulics #2  
Unless your valve has detent, you have to use a bungee to lock the valve open.

Run your log splitter valve OUT line to tank.
